Output 958bb5abd1df83b3c40f854f6d937fd5ce219dda3761dc0bddbbc24e4c29df67:2

value
4110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d873df7fd5034ace367f1ee62276339b981209ef OP_EQUAL
address
3MRWgykun6Ywxnv8XJZAy4Df68ixizzUha
transaction
958bb5abd1df83b3c40f854f6d937fd5ce219dda3761dc0bddbbc24e4c29df67
confirmations
168440
spent
true